At the school bookstore, Quinn purchased a binder for $4.75 and 4 pens for $0.79 each. What was Quinn's total cost

2 Answers

7 votes

Answer:

Quinn's total cost was $7.91.

Explanation:

You already know the binder is $4.75 so that remains the same.

You have to find the total cost for all the 4 pens:

$0.79

x 4

--------

$3.16

Add up the cost of the binder w/ the cost of the 4 pens:

$4.75

+

$3.16

---------

$7.91
